Desenvolvimento Web em 2025: IA, Testes e Performance na Prática
Desenvolvimento web em 2025 é a camada principal de contato entre marca e cliente. PWAs instaláveis, edge computing, WebAssembly e IA integrada ao fluxo de trabalho redefiniram o que significa entregar um produto digital competitivo — e equipes que ainda operam com stacks frágeis e QA manual estão pagando o preço em bugs em produção, páginas lentas e conversões abaixo do potencial.
Este guia mostra como organizar um stack moderno, integrar IA ao ciclo de desenvolvimento, estruturar testes com cobertura real e escolher arquiteturas que entregam velocidade, qualidade e escala.
Por que desenvolvimento web continua no centro da estratégia digital
O browser virou o sistema operacional da internet. Análises da Rocketseat sobre tendências de desenvolvimento web em 2025 mostram IA como copiloto, WebAssembly ganhando espaço e a web ocupando casos antes dominados por apps nativos.
Do lado do CMS, o WordPress ainda responde por uma fatia enorme da web. Relatórios da Kinsta sobre tendências de WordPress para 2025 apontam a transição definitiva para temas em blocos, arquitetura headless e uso intenso de APIs. Muito do que o usuário percebe como "produto digital" ainda é desenvolvimento web em essência.
No cenário global, estudos da Digital Silk reforçam que uma parcela crescente de desenvolvedores prioriza competências de web development em 2025, o que se traduz em disputa acirrada por talentos capazes de alinhar código, arquitetura e resultado de negócio.
A forma mais prática de acompanhar essa evolução sem se perder em modismos é tratar seu ecossistema como um painel de controle de métricas: velocidade, qualidade, segurança e experiência do usuário como indicadores vivos, não como checklist de projeto.
Stack moderno de desenvolvimento web em 2025
Um stack competitivo precisa equilibrar três dimensões: experiência de usuário, produtividade de desenvolvimento e capacidade de evoluir rápido. As tendências destacadas pela Rocketseat e pelo blog UX4You sobre desenvolvimento web orientado por IA reforçam esse tripé.
Um desenho prático de stack para 2025:
- Front-end: framework reativo (React, Vue ou Svelte) com meta-framework focado em performance, como Next.js ou Nuxt
- Back-end: APIs em Node ou Deno com suporte sólido a TypeScript
- Infraestrutura: funções serverless para picos de carga, banco gerenciado e CDN com edge para conteúdo estático e rotas críticas
- Experiência: PWA com push notifications, cache inteligente e modo offline para rotas-chave
- Ferramentas de IA: copiloto para geração de código e testes, sempre com revisão humana
Esse stack só funciona ancorado em padrões sólidos da web. Isso inclui seguir a documentação do MDN sobre APIs web modernas e aplicar boas práticas de acessibilidade, segurança e SEO desde o início.
Defina metas técnicas claras para orientar decisões de arquitetura:
- LCP abaixo de 2,5 s nas principais páginas
- TTFB abaixo de 500 ms nas rotas críticas
- 95% das respostas de API em menos de 300 ms em horário de pico
Testes, QA e cobertura: blindando seu código em produção
Não existe desenvolvimento web moderno sem uma estratégia séria de testes e validação. Com releases frequentes, feature flags e integrações complexas, confiar só em testes manuais é garantia de descobrir problemas em produção.
Níveis de testes que não podem faltar
Uma estratégia mínima de qualidade inclui quatro camadas:
- Testes unitários para funções puras, hooks, serviços e utilitários — use Jest ou Vitest para cobrir a lógica crítica
- Testes de integração para fluxos envolvendo banco, filas e serviços externos — Playwright e Cypress ajudam a validar além de componentes isolados
- Testes end-to-end (E2E) para os principais fluxos de negócio: cadastro, login, checkout e contato — o objetivo é validar a jornada completa, não cada detalhe de UI
- Testes de contrato e API para garantir que mudanças em uma API não quebrem consumidores existentes, especialmente em arquiteturas com front-end e back-end desacoplados
Com essas camadas estruturadas, o time de QA deixa de ser um "achador de bugs" e passa a atuar como parceiro de engenharia, projetando estratégias de validação junto com desenvolvimento.
Metas de cobertura e qualidade mínimas
Cobertura não é tudo, mas é um termômetro confiável. Para sistemas web de negócio, uma boa meta fica entre 70% e 90% das linhas de código, com foco nas áreas de maior risco.
Mais importante que o número bruto é como a cobertura orienta decisões:
- Falha de pipeline quando a cobertura global cai abaixo do limite acordado
- Regras específicas para módulos críticos: autenticação, cobrança e gateways de pagamento
- Revisão obrigatória de testes em toda pull request que altera regras de negócio
Use ferramentas como Istanbul/nyc ou a integração nativa de frameworks para conectar resultados ao painel de métricas. Combine automação com QA exploratório focado em cenários reais para equilibrar velocidade e inteligência humana.
Arquiteturas focadas em performance: PWAs, serverless, edge e WebAssembly
Considere um squad lançando uma PWA de e-commerce durante a Black Friday. Se a página inicial leva 5 segundos para carregar em 4G, a taxa de abandono explode. É aqui que arquitetura faz toda a diferença.
Fontes como Computação Livre e UX4You destacam o impacto de PWAs combinadas com serverless para apps escaláveis. PWAs bem implementadas reduzem tempo de carregamento, funcionam offline em rotas críticas e entregam experiência quase nativa sem depender de lojas de aplicativos.
Do lado da infraestrutura, funções serverless em AWS, Azure ou Cloudflare Workers lidam com picos de tráfego sem manter servidores ociosos. Levar lógica próxima do usuário com edge computing reduz latência global e melhora métricas de conversão diretamente.
Performance também é foco em Core Web Vitals. A documentação oficial do Google em Core Web Vitals e experiência de página mostra o impacto direto de LCP, CLS e FID em SEO e satisfação do usuário.
Para cenários com lógica pesada no front-end — editores de vídeo, dashboards de dados complexos — WebAssembly permite levar código de alto desempenho ao navegador sem abandonar o ecossistema web.
Regras práticas de arquitetura para performance:
- Tudo que é estático vai para CDN e edge
- Tudo que é interativo, mas não crítico, pode ser carregado sob demanda
- Tudo que é crítico de negócio precisa ser otimizado primeiro em payload, compressão e caching
WordPress, low-code e no-code como aceleradores estratégicos
Não faz sentido falar de desenvolvimento web em produção sem considerar o peso de WordPress, low-code e no-code. Análises da Kinsta sobre tendências de WordPress para 2025 e da Muahoo sobre a evolução do full-site editing no WordPress mostram que boa parte da web corporativa será construída com blocos reutilizáveis e integrações via API.
Para equipes técnicas, isso significa mudar o foco de "codar tudo do zero" para orquestrar componentes, criar blocos customizados e garantir segurança, performance e integração com sistemas internos. Desenvolvimento web vira mais arquitetura e menos montagem de páginas estáticas.
Plataformas low-code e no-code, apontadas em análises da Exploding Topics sobre tendências globais de desenvolvimento de software, democratizam a criação de soluções simples e são ótimas para prototipar, validar hipóteses e construir ferramentas internas.
A chave é definir fronteiras claras:
- Use WordPress, low-code e no-code para conteúdo, landing pages e ferramentas não críticas
- Use desenvolvimento sob medida para módulos centrais, integrações sensíveis, regras de negócio complexas e diferenciais competitivos
No painel de métricas, acompanhe o impacto dessas escolhas em tempo de entrega, taxa de bugs e custo de manutenção ao longo do tempo.
IA em todo o ciclo de desenvolvimento web
Quase todas as fontes recentes de tendências — de Rocketseat a Smashing Magazine — convergem no mesmo ponto: IA já faz parte do fluxo de desenvolvimento web. O debate deixou de ser "usar ou não usar IA" e passou a ser "como usar sem perder qualidade e domínio técnico".
Ferramentas de IA generativa auxiliam em várias etapas:
- Planejamento: rascunho de histórias de usuário, critérios de aceitação e casos de teste
- Código: geração inicial de componentes, funções utilitárias e consultas a APIs
- Testes: sugestão de cenários de validação e dados de teste mais ricos
- Documentação: sumarização de decisões de arquitetura e mudanças de comportamento de APIs
Ao mesmo tempo, tratar IA como substituta total do desenvolvedor é um risco real. A boa prática é adotar IA como par-programmer: ela gera código, mas a equipe continua responsável por design, entendimento profundo da tecnologia, revisões e decisões de arquitetura.
Políticas claras para uso de IA no desenvolvimento:
- Todo código gerado por IA passa por revisão de pelo menos um desenvolvedor experiente
- Trechos sensíveis — criptografia, autenticação, compliance — não são aceitos apenas com base em sugestão automática
- IA amplia cobertura de testes e documentação, não substitui etapas de QA ou validação
Quando bem integrada ao fluxo, IA acelera o desenvolvimento web sem sacrificar segurança, qualidade ou domínio técnico.
Plano de ação em 90 dias para atualizar seu desenvolvimento web
Saber o que é importante é só metade do trabalho. A outra metade é transformar isso em um plano concreto que caiba na rotina do time.
Dias 0 a 30: diagnóstico e fundamentos
- Faça um inventário de sistemas web, frameworks, bibliotecas e integrações atuais
- Levante métricas básicas: LCP, TTFB, taxa de erro, cobertura de testes, número de incidentes em produção
- Mapeie o fluxo de desenvolvimento atual, do backlog ao deploy, e identifique gargalos
- Escolha um conjunto pequeno de metas para o painel de métricas, como reduzir tempo médio de deploy ou aumentar cobertura em módulos críticos
Dias 31 a 60: arquitetura e automação
- Selecione uma aplicação piloto para implementar PWA, cache offline e otimizações de performance
- Introduza funções serverless ou edge em uma parte do sistema com alto pico de acesso
- Estruture pipeline de CI/CD com etapas claras de build, testes automatizados, análise estática e validação de cobertura
- Defina e documente o mínimo de testes necessário por tipo de mudança
- Avalie onde WordPress, low-code ou no-code podem acelerar entregas sem comprometer arquitetura
Dias 61 a 90: otimização contínua
- Revise decisões de arquitetura à luz dos indicadores do painel de métricas
- Ajuste metas de Core Web Vitals com base em benchmarks de mercado
- Amplie uso de IA para geração de testes, refactorings seguros e documentação de APIs
- Estruture retrospectivas técnicas mensais focando não só em código, mas em processos de QA, validação e comunicação entre produto e engenharia
Ao final dos 90 dias, você não terá "terminado" a modernização. Terá estabelecido uma base sólida de arquitetura, automação, testes e métricas que permite evoluir o desenvolvimento web de forma previsível.
Próximos passos para o seu time
Desenvolvimento web em 2025 é menos sobre escolher o framework da moda e mais sobre orquestrar bem um conjunto de práticas, tecnologias e métricas. IA, PWAs, serverless, WordPress, low-code, testes automatizados e performance são peças de um mesmo quebra-cabeça.
Ao tratar seu ecossistema como um painel de controle de métricas, você ganha clareza sobre onde investir: reduzir tempo de carregamento, aumentar cobertura de testes, melhorar acessibilidade, cortar custos de infraestrutura ou acelerar o ciclo de deploy.
O passo seguinte é escolher uma ou duas frentes prioritárias e começar pequeno, com uma aplicação piloto e metas claras. A partir daí, você escala o que funcionou para o restante do portfólio. O time deixa de apagar incêndios em produção e passa a usar desenvolvimento web como vantagem competitiva real, sustentada por código de qualidade, processos maduros de QA e arquitetura pronta para o futuro.